Code and Waves

Launching software and AI products
for Founders and Teams

Tell me what you're building

About Me

Hi there! I'm João, a Product Engineer with 8+ years of experience helping businesses solve real problems through technology. Originally from Portugal and based in the Netherlands, I specialize in Ruby on Rails, Next.js, React, AWS, and practical AI/LLM integrations.

I work with founders and teams who want to shape an idea into a real product. Whether the challenge is a new SaaS, product improvements, or AI features that actually help users, I bring the technical judgment and hands-on implementation to move it forward.

Building software that feels clear, useful, and made for real people. 🤝 Cross-functional collaboration • ☕ Coffee enthusiast • 🧠 Strategic thinker • 🎯 Product-focused

Joao Silva

Experience

Over 8 years of experience building scalable software solutions across various industries, with a strong focus on modern product development, AI-assisted workflows, and LLM-powered features.

8+
Years Experience
5+
Industries
8+
Clients Served
Granino

Granino

Building Granino from scratch: a specialty coffee platform to discover beans, cafés, and roasters based on personal taste. Created from my own need and used as a learning-by-doing project with Next.js, Supabase, Vercel, AI, and modern web technologies.

Side ProjectNext.jsReactSupabaseUser Testing
Visit Website →
Old Mates Advice

Old Mates Advice

Technical Co-Founder building a SaaS platform from the ground up. Our goal is to help businesses in Australia deliver video consultations and unlock valuable insights for house inspections, electrification, and more.

Ruby on RailsSaaSB2BTechnical Co-Founder
Visit Website →
IbiCasa

Ibicasa

Migrated PHP application to Ruby on Rails for Ibiza-based real estate client, moved infrastructure to AWS, and built integrations with external services like Idealista. Delivered complete website redesign for improved performance.

PHP to Rails MigrationAWS InfrastructureAPI IntegrationsPerformance Optimization
Visit Website →
RegLab

RegLab

Building Anti-Money Laundering (AML) compliance software for professional services across multiple European countries. Developing features to ensure clients meet local regulatory requirements in Netherlands and other European countries.

Ruby on RailsB2BMulti-Country OperationsRegTech
Visit Website →
Tablevibe

Tablevibe

Integrated multiple food delivery partners (Foodpanda, Uber Eats, Grab) across Singapore, Philippines and Australia, serving 1000+ daily orders. Built coupon system for restaurant marketing campaigns with usage tracking.

API integrationsRuby on RailsRemoteAPAC Region
Visit Website →
SuperYacht Times

SuperYacht Times

Solo engineer leading software development. Implemented full website redesign with UX/UI team and built custom architecture to integrate Unity 3D worlds into the web platform.

Ruby on RailsUnity 3D IntegrationLead EngineerUX/UI Collaboration
Visit Website →
StashFriend

StashFriend

Built peer-to-peer storage platform from scratch for the Netherlands market, allowing people to rent unused space in their homes for storage. Led full-stack development and supported business decisions over 3+ years.

Ruby on RailsFull-Stack DevelopmentP2P PlatformEntrepreneurship
No longer active

Industries

Experience across diverse industries, bringing technical expertise to solve unique business challenges.

Media & PublishingReal EstateFood & BeverageFashionAdvertisingYacht IndustryHome RenovationProfessional ServicesLegalTech

Side Projects

Side projects where I tackle real problems I've encountered or heard others struggling with, often using AI and LLM APIs to learn, experiment, and create something genuinely useful.

Find Coupon Code webpage

FindCouponCode

AI-powered tool that finds hidden coupon codes for any website URL. Built as a weekend project using Perplexity AI and LLM-driven search to turn messy web results into useful coupon suggestions. Browser extension coming soon.

Next.jsAI IntegrationPerplexity APIWeekend Project
Visit Website →
TracklistFinder webpage

TracklistFinder

Turn any YouTube video into a Spotify playlist with one click. Uses AI and LLM-based parsing to extract track names from DJ sets, live mixes, and music compilations, then instantly creates a Spotify playlist with all the songs.

AI IntegrationSpotify APIYouTubeSide Project
Visit Website →

Get in Touch

Whether you need help bringing a software idea to life, exploring AI/LLM features, or adding technical expertise to an existing project, let’s chat and see how I can help, no matter your industry or location.